    Product Specifications
    • Other Name: Condenser Assembly; A/C Condenser; Condenser Assembly, Cooler
    • Part Name Code: 88460
    • Item Weight: 7.60 Pounds
    • Item Dimensions: 33.3 x 20.2 x 4.1 inches
    • Condition: New
    • Fitment Type: Direct Replacement
    • SKU: 88460-20560
    • Warranty: This genuine part is guaranteed by Toyota's factory warranty.
    More Info
    Fits the following 2000 Toyota Celica Submodels:
    • GT, GTS | 4 Cyl 1.8 L GAS

  • Q: How to service and repair the A/C Condenser on 2000 Toyota Celica?
    A: The first step for HVAC condenser service requires refrigerant discarding from the refrigeration system before evacuating air and adding 430 plus or minus 30 g (15.17 plus or minus 1.06 oz.) of refrigerant for leak inspection. The first step involves extracting the front bumper then uninstalling both tubes from the discharge hose and the liquid tube after removing 2 bolts while tightening them to 5.4 Nm torque (55 kg.cm or 48 inch lbs force). Install new 2 O-rings into the tubes by lubricating them with compressor oil before installing them on the open fittings to cap them immediately. This action stops moisture from entering the system. First you should remove the radiator upper mountings by disassembling 2 bolts and 2 nuts together with 2 upper mountings. Safely remove the condenser after finishing the above process. When changing the condenser install 40 cc (1.4 fl.oz.) ND-OIL 8 or similar compressor oil in the compressor unit. The installation process completes opposite to what was used during removal.
